Even though it doesn’t feel like spring is in the air, fashion and beauty carries on! This and next week we will have a look at some spring hair tips.
Dana Ionato, a colorist at Sally Hershberger Downtown, specializes in blondes and provides some blonde trends and tips for spring.
1. Newest Spring Trend: Icy Blondes, Cool Blondes, with blue and purple undertones, staying away from gold. This process is more high maintenance, so ask your colorist the best way to achieve the look. The best way to get cool blonde is to double process your natural color, and follow up with a few highlights after to soften any warmth that may come with the first time going lighter. After that, the maintenance should be simply a bleach on scalp on your re-growth, The first appointment could take up to 4 hours if done right. Then after the re-touch will only take half of the time. The problem is getting out warmth: there is no good way to speed this up, you must be patient. Bring a good book or your ipad, maybe your tax receipts? It’s a good time to delete old emails, or update your contacts list.
Beauty icons: Alfred Hitchcock blondes such as Kim Novak in Vertigo. In the realm of icy blondes, Kim Novak is positively glacial. Also seen on Sienna Miller, January Jones, and Debra-Lee Jackman. Kate Bosworth is a cool blonde, her ultra-light blonde hue is beachy to the extreme.

3. Trick for unruly hair: stay within two shades of your natural. The farther you go away form natural, when your hair is super frizzy, the light will reflect off the lighter pieces which in turn actually make your hair look super dry. Get a keratin treatment, I promise the pollutants you get from alcohol alone or more harmful than any chemical in one keratin treatment. It will save your life. Cuts blow dry time in half, never gets frizzy, I live by them.

Here are some newer and current faves of mine in hair products.
Aveda’s new Invati™ is an innovative system created to provide a solution for thinning hair and hair loss due to breakage. The line features 97% naturally-derived products. It includes the Exfoliating Shampoo, a gentle shampoo that cleanses, exfoliates and renews the scalp with wintergreen-derived salicylic acid. The Thickening Conditioner strengthens with arginine, an amino acid derived from sugar beets and soy protein, and organic kukui nut oil to add natural shine. The Scalp Revitalizer utilizes turmeric and ginseng to help energize and rehabilitate the scalp around the follicles when massaged in. (Available at aveda.com.)
